
The Billing Assistant is responsible for computing manpower deployment schedules in preparation for the invoicing process, preparing and sending invoices and Statements of Account (SOA) to debtors, and sending Official Receipts (ORs) to debtors in a timely and accurate manner.
Duties and Responsibilities
1. Manpower Deployment
To coordinate with the Human Resources (HR) Team to obtain, validate, and consolidate manpower deployment schedules and supporting documents required for the billing process. Ensure the accuracy and completeness of deployment information, resolve any discrepancies with the HR Team, and prepare the finalized manpower deployment schedules as the basis for the timely and accurate generation of invoices.
2. Sending of Statement of Account and Invoice
Ensures timely release of Statements of Account (SOA) based on the agreed schedule. Performs reconciliation of tenant accounts prior to issuance to ensure all charges and adjustments are complete and accurate.
3. Sending of Official Receipts
To prepare and send Official Receipts (ORs) to debtors upon verification of proof of payment received from Property Managers, debtors, the Treasury Team, and the Accounts Payable Team. Ensure payments are accurately applied to the corresponding invoices, coordinate any discrepancies with the concerned teams, and issue ORs in a timely and accurate manner.
4. Ad Hoc Tasks
Provides support to Billing Associates, Lead, and Manager in day-to-day billing operations. Assists in report generation, urgent requirements, and participates in process improvement and automation initiatives.

Filinvest Development Corp. (FDC) is one of the leading, most stable and diversified conglomerates in the Philippines. Through its diverse businesses, FDC has established a strong reputation as a dependable partner in economic development. FDC currently has strategic holdings in key industries such as real estate development and leasing, banking and financial services, hotel and resort management, power generation and sugar.
